Muskingum County, OH
At 86,410 residents, Muskingum County is a large county in Ohio. FBI UCR county totals below are read before any per-100,000 rate (Census denominator when matched).
Muskingum County, OH reported 176 violent crimes per 100,000 in FBI UCR 2024
According to the FBI Uniform Crime Reporting (UCR) Program for 2024, Muskingum County, OH agencies reported 152 violent and 503 property offenses. That equals about 176 violent and 582 property crimes per 100,000 using a verified Census population join. Table 10 coverage is a voluntary subset of U.S. counties.

Position in the state cohort
Muskingum County reported the highest violent-crime rate among comparable Ohio counties
At 175.9 reported violent offenses per 100,000 residents in 2024, Muskingum County ranks 1 of 66 — above 65 of the 65 other Ohio counties whose 2024 submission passes this site’s completeness test and carries a matched Census denominator. That is +302.8% against the cohort median of 43.7. Counties that did not report, or that reported implausibly low totals, are excluded from this cohort rather than counted as low-crime.
Offense mix
Violent offenses make up an unusually large share of the reported mix
Violent offenses are 23.2% of the 655 Part I offenses reported in Muskingum County for 2024, against a median of 14.7% across comparable Ohio counties — a gap of 8.5 points. Offense mix is shaped by which agencies report and how incidents are classified as well as by the underlying offenses, so it describes the reported record rather than a settled difference in conditions.

Reporting Agency
Muskingum County Sheriff's Office NIBRS-participating
Muskingum County's crime figures on this page originate from Muskingum County Sheriff's Office's submission to the FBI's Uniform Crime Reporting Program.
This agency reports via NIBRS, the incident-based system that captures more detail per offense (multiple crimes per incident, victim/offender data) than the older summary counts.
